Jurnal Teknik Informatika (JUTIF)
Vol. 7 No. 3 (2026): JUTIF Volume 7, Number 3, June 2026

Optimization of ShuffleNetV2 Using Self-Knowledge Distillation for Cocoa Fruit Disease Classification

H.R Merdu Wira Jasa (Information Systems, STIKOM Tunas Bangsa, Indonesia)
Anjar Wanto (Information Systems, STIKOM Tunas Bangsa, Indonesia)
Rizky Khairunnisa Sormin (Information Systems, STIKOM Tunas Bangsa, Indonesia)



Article Info

Publish Date
15 Jun 2026

Abstract

Timely cocoa fruit disease diagnosis is critical for field management, yet manual inspection is subjective and inconsistent, while many accurate deep learning models remain too computationally demanding for practical on-device use. This study aims to optimize cocoa fruit disease classification by applying self-knowledge distillation (Self-KD) to a lightweight ShuffleNetV2 architecture without increasing inference complexity. Using a three-class dataset (healthy, pod borer, and black pod rot) with preprocessing and class balancing, ShuffleNetV2 was selected as the baseline and trained with Self-KD, improving accuracy from 96.84% to 98.34% along with consistent gains in precision, recall, and F1-score. These results indicate that Self-KD provides a learning-level optimization that enhances robustness and prediction stability in lightweight CNNs, which is especially relevant for edge AI deployment in agricultural environments. Therefore, the proposed approach supports efficient, scalable, and sustainability-oriented AI (Green/Sustainable AI) for smart farming, with potential transferability to other crops that exhibit similar visual symptom patterns.

Copyrights © 2026






Journal Info

Abbrev

jurnal

Publisher

Subject

Computer Science & IT

Description

Jurnal Teknik Informatika (JUTIF) is an Indonesian national journal, publishes high-quality research papers in the broad field of Informatics, Information Systems and Computer Science, which encompasses software engineering, information system development, computer systems, computer network, ...